Trade the Day: An Introduction to Day Trading

Day trading is a trading style that focuses on reaping benefits from stock market fluctuations within a single day. This practice requires traders to carry out both buying and selling actions in just one trading day.

Fundamentally, day trading is about seizing opportunities in small price changes within the day. However, it's important to website note that it is a risky yet potentially rewarding pursuit needing thorough knowledge of the stock market.

Why might someone opt for day trading? Well, it has its allure. Day trading allows you to be your boss, take charge of your decisions and potentially make considerable earnings. Furthermore, technology advancements have facilitated the ease and convenience of day trading, allowing anyone willing to learn, the ability to participate in these markets - from anywhere, at any time.

However, it's not all roses and rainbows. Day trading requires a firm commitment to learning and understanding various approaches and strategies. It necessitates continual watchfulness, as you must be ready to react quickly to market volatility.

A beginner looking to venture into day trading must learn considerably about technical analysis, the study of market actions primarily using price charts for making trading decisions. It is also essential to have a strategically engineered trading plan, which functions as a roadmap for all trading actions.

One of the primary aspects of day trading is managing risk. Given the volatile nature of day trading, mastering risk-management techniques becomes vital, helping traders to protect their investment.

Day trading, like any other profession, cannot guarantee success overnight. It is a skill that is honed over time, and patience invariably pays off. By crafting methodical strategies and keeping an eye on market dynamics, traders can potentially enjoy high returns in the long run.

In conclusion, day trading offers the promise of financial independence and significant returns, if approached with intelligence, discipline, and an earnest desire to learn. No matter the method, success in day trading demands patience, knowledge, and rock-solid strategies.
